Camden International Film Festival

We just got back from Maine where RiseUp was screened at The Camden International Film Festival.  We had a great time meeting  other immensely talented filmmakers and talking to enthusiastic audience members about how we got the film completed.  Big thanks to the fantastic Ben Fowlie and Leah Hurley who ran the festival.  What a great adventure - check out the pics!
